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Lenguajes De Simulacion Y PROMODEL


Enviado por   •  14 de Diciembre de 2013  •  1.969 Palabras (8 Páginas)  •  513 Visitas

Página 1 de 8

** Tabla de contenido **

*Lenguajes de simulación

*Clasificación de los software

*GASP IV

*SIMSCRIPT II.5

*SIMAN/CINEMA

*SLAM II

*PROMODEL (aplicaciones y características)

1.- investigacion de los diferentes programas para simulacion lista y una breve descripción

introduccion

Muchas propiedades en programaci6n de modelos de simulacion discreta, tales como:

• Generadores de n6meros aleatorios.

• Generadores do variables aleatorias.

• Rutinas del siguiente evento.

• Avance de tiempo.

• Recopilaci6n de estadisticas.

• Reportes, etc.

Han sido desarrolladas an lenguajes especiales, orientados a simulaci6n, dejando la ardua labor de

programacion an FORTRAN, C, o PASCAL a lenguajes de simulacion, los qua incluyen facilidades

de animaci6n. Actualmente, existen cerca de 100 software de simulacion, disponibles an una varie-

dad de computadores.

LENGUAJES DE SIMULACIÓN Y LENGUAJES DE PROPÓSITOS GENERALES

La importancia de escribir modelos de simulación en lenguajes de propósitos generales como FORTRAN radica en:

• Permite conocer los detalles íntimos de la simulación.

• Es imprescindible, cuando no se dispone de software de simulación.

• Algunos modelos en lenguajes de simulación permiten interfaces con lenguajes generales, específicamente FORTRAN (ocurre con SLAM ll, SIMAN, GPSS).

Por otra parte, los lenguajes de simulación ofrecen mayores ventajas, porque:

• Automáticamente proveen muchas de las facilidades necesarias en la simulación del modelo.

• Proveen un natural ambiente para modelamiento de la simulación.

• Son fáciles de usar.

• Proveen una gran interacción entre edición, depuración y ejecución. Alcanzando algunos de ellos implantación de la ingeniería de software.

CLASIFICACIÓN DE LOS SOTWARE PARA SIMULACIÓN

Existen en el mercado dos grandes clases de software para simulación: los lenguajes y los simuladores. Un lenguaje de simulación es un software de simulación de naturaleza general y posee algunas características especiales para ciertas aplicaciones, tal como ocurre con SLAM 11 y SIMAN con sus módulos de manufactura. El modelo es desarrollado usando las instrucciones adecuadas del lenguaje y permitiendo al analista un gran control para cualquier clase de sistema.

Un simulador (o de propósitos especiales) es un paquete de computadoras que permite realizar la simulación para un ambiente específico, no requiriendo esfuerzo en programación. Hoy en día existen simuladores para ambientes de manufactura y sistemas de comunicación permitiendo un menor tiempo en el desarrollo del modelo, así como también contar con el personal sin experiencia en simulación.

Los simuladores son actualmente muy utilizados para análisis en alto nivel, requiriéndose únicamente agregar detalles en un cierto nivel, puesto que lo demás es estándar.

CACI Products Company autor de SIMSCRIPT 11.5 es también autor de los simuladores SIMFACTORY 11.5, NETWORK 11.5 y COMNET 11.5, muy utilizados en estos últimos tiempos para simulaciones de sistemas de manufacturas, redes de computadoras y redes de telecomunicaciones.

Para procesar transacciones en espera de un ordenamiento, un lenguaje de simulación debe proporcionar un medio automático de almacenamiento y recuperación de estas entidades. Atendiendo a la orientación del modelamiento de una simulación discreta, existen tres formas:

1. Programación de eventos.

2. Procesos.

3. Examinación de actividades.

Una programación al evento es modelada, identificando las características del evento y luego se escriben un juego de rutinas para los eventos con la finalidad de describir detalladamente los cambios que ocurren en el tiempo en cada evento. Lenguajes como SIMSCRIPT 11.5 y SLAM 11 están orientados al evento.

Una interacción al proceso es una secuencia de tiempos interrelacionados, describiendo la experiencia de una entidad a través del sistema. Por ejemplo, en un modelo de colas esta "historia" se traduce en el paso del tiempo del ingreso a la cola, ingreso al servidor, paso del tiempo en el servicio y fin del servicio . GPSS, SIMAN y SIMNET son orientados al proceso.

En el examen de actividades, el modelador define las condiciones necesarias al empezar y finalizar cada actividad en el sistema. El tiempo es avanzado en iguales incrementos de tiempo y en cada incremento de tiempo, las condiciones son evaluadas para determinar si alguna actividad puede estar empezando o terminando. El ESCL, es un lenguaje de simulación muy popular en Europa y fue desarrollado en FORTRAN.

GASP IV

Es una colección de subrutinas FORTRAN, diseñadas para facilitar la simulación de secuencia de eventos. Cerca de 30 subrutinas y funciones que proveen numerosas facilidades, incluyendo:

• Rutinas de avance del tiempo,

• Gestión de listas de eventos futuros,

• Adición y remoción de entidades.

• Colección de estadísticas.

• Generadores

...

Descargar como (para miembros actualizados)  txt (14 Kb)  
Leer 7 páginas más »
Disponible sólo en Clubensayos.com